Tree lopping service involves the careful removal of specific branches or sections of a tree to improve its health, safety, or appearance. Skilled professionals utilize specialized tools and techniques to prune trees in a controlled manner, ensuring the remaining structure remains stable and healthy. This service often focuses on removing dead, damaged, or overgrown branches that may pose risks to property or people, as well as shaping the tree to promote better growth patterns. Proper tree lopping can help maintain the overall vitality of the tree while reducing the likelihood of future problems.
One of the primary issues addressed by tree lopping services is the mitigation of safety hazards. Overgrown branches can become weak and susceptible to breaking during storms or high winds, potentially causing damage to nearby structures or injury to individuals. Additionally, trees that are too close to power lines or buildings may need selective pruning to prevent interference or accidents. Tree lopping also helps prevent the spread of disease or pests by removing infected or infested limbs, thereby protecting the health of the entire tree.

The overview below groups typical Tree Lopping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Morristown,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Average Cost Range - Tree lopping services typically cost between $200 and $800 per job, depending on the size and complexity of the tree. For example, a small tree removal may be around $200, while larger trees can reach $800 or more.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all price can vary based on tree height, location, and accessibility. Trees in hard-to-reach areas or requiring special equipment may increase costs beyond the base range.
Additional Charges - Extra fees may apply for stump grinding, debris removal, or pruning services. These can add several hundred dollars to the total cost, depending on the scope of work.
Regional Variations - Costs can differ by location, with urban areas like Morristown, NJ, often experiencing higher prices due to labor and permit requirements. Contact local pros for precise est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
